A Treasury of English Wild Life

by Turner, W.J. (Ed.)

Description:

Includes chapters by leading naturalists of the day: Trees in Britain by Alexander L. Howard, Wild Flowers in Britain by Geoffrey Grigson, Wild Life of Britain by F. Fraser Darling, The Birds of Britain by James Fisher, British Marine Life by C. M. Yonge and Insect Life in Britain by Geoffrey Taylor. The dust wrapper states that the authors ‘are diverse in their approach and styles but share at least two things- real knowledge and literary ability.
